Marco Chiudinelli from Switzerland joins the podcast this week 🇨🇭

Marco had a 17 year long career, which saw him rise to a career high #52 as well as winning the Davis Cup with Switzerland in 2014 🏆


We talk:

  • What life after tennis looks like
  • Running Tennis Camps
  • Can Novak compete the Golden Slam?
  • What he misses from travelling on tour
  • Winning the Davis Cup
